Can Rejuvenate be used on vinyl plank floors?

RejuvenateĀ® Luxury Vinyl Flooring Cleaner is the perfect daily cleaner for all your vinyl floor tiles. As it is a pH neutral formula, it can be safely used on any luxury vinyl floor (LVT) without leaving streaks or dull residue.

So how does rejuvenation work?

Rejuvenates the effect by filling in scratches and restoring traction. The polymer-based formula brightens and protects all sealed wood floors by sliding and drying in a thin protective layer. Wear causes scratches that affect the entire floor surface.

How to clean the floors after using rejuvenation?

Remove the Rejuvenate Floor Renovator with the vinegar.

  1. Pour 1 cup of white vinegar and 1 liter of warm water into the cleaning bucket.
  2. Stir the mop into the mixture and squeeze it out as much as possible, making sure the water runs out into the bucket.
